A shipyard area under construction is a bustling site of activity, where teams of workers, heavy machinery, and materials come together to build or expand the shipyard's infrastructure. This area may feature large cranes, excavators, and concrete mixers working to erect new dry docks, assembly platforms, or storage facilities. Construction zones are often cordoned off for safety, with strict regulations in place to protect workers and equipment. The ground may be a mix of exposed earth, scaffolding, and newly poured foundations, with welding sparks and the sound of machinery filling the air. Once completed, these developments will enhance the shipyard's capacity to build, repair, and maintain larger or more sophisticated vessels, contributing to the overall growth of the maritime industry within the Solomon Islands.
